Hi! I believe that you confused the buildings a little. The building shown here is actually Dyer Federal Building And Courthouse and not the old post office. The post office would be further down the street towards Flagler. This building is in front of Miami Dade College

I remember this building. It was one of the biggest building I ever seen in 1967, just arrived from Guatemala. Saw the first White and colored water fountains inside the halls. very surprised. Very grand... Across now is the Miami Dade Community college. Used to lived in 6 st and miami ave. There used to be a peanut factory where you could buy hot peanuts in a small brown bag. Too bad I did not have pictures from back then. I was only 12.
